Brown Ideye Happy To Start 2016 With A Goal
Brown Ideye was satisfied after Olympiakos<span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\">’ 3 - 1 win over </span></span></span>Panionios in the Greek Super League, and he capped off an imperious display by netting his seventh goal of the season across all competitions.<br /><br />With the defending champions 2 - 1 up, the Nigeria international effectively killed the game as a contest when he scored in the 79th minute.<br /><br /><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\">“</span></span></span></span></span></span>So good to begin the year with a Bang!! Difficult game tonight but we came back strong🔴⚪️ #thankful #olympiacos , <span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"> </span></span></span></span></span></span><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\"><span class=\"body1\">” the Olympiakos number 99 tweeted.<br /><br />Olympiakos have won their first 16 games in the Super League in the ongoing season, with Ideye suiting up in 13 of those games and from the very beginning.<br /><br />Nearest challengers AEK Athens are 18 points off the pace after The Reds win on Sunday.<br /></span></span></span></span></span></span></span></span></span></span></span>
